Senator Joe Manchin III’s Regional Coordinator Ben Spurlock visited the Summers County Council on Aging, Inc today to talk about the Inflation Reduction Act and how it positively serves our Seniors by lowering the cost of healthcare. We have posted a bit of literature given to us today to help communicate the timeline and specifics happening regarding that.

The Senior Center and their employees are such a huge asset to our community. They provide transportation with their buses to help offset the burden of travel to and from Doctor visits, hot and fresh lunches, and much much more. Mayor Scott expressed his deep appreciation for this organization and the importance of us as a community pulling together and supporting them.
